For the perfect dinner party

Some of the best photos you’ll ever take are from gatherings with good friends in relaxed surroundings.

Import the photos from your dinner party into MediaShow and use FaceMe™ face recognition to tag everyone – it makes trying to locate a specific snap later so much easier (and a lot easier to remember the names of new people you’ve just met that night!).

One of the problems with indoor shots at night can be the lighting. Photos are often too dark. With MediaShow you can use one-click lighting adjustment to correct overly dark photos. And to save a lot of time, you can apply the fix to all your photos in one batch.

These days, the quickest way to share photos with friends is by uploading them to Facebook. MediaShow makes the process even quicker by helping you to post your pre-tagged snaps to Facebook directly from the software interface. You can do your sorting, tagging, editing and sharing all in the one place.

For keeping track of the grandkids

For those not active on social media websites, keeping up-to-date with friends and family is often dependent on expensive phone calls and a few emailed photos here and there.

MediaShow can be set to monitor folders located on free online storage repositories like Dropbox. MediaShow will automatically update as new photos or videos are placed into the online storage site. Just open MediaShow to check whether the kids or grandkids have dropped anything new in there – super quick and easy and no need to navigate confusing websites.

And if there’s a certain photo you particularly like, MediaShow can print it out for you so you can hang it up around the house.

For even friendlier Facebook

These days almost everyone is on Facebook. Keeping up with all the new photos and videos your friends upload can be very time consuming.

Clicking on the Facebook tab in the Media Library lets you see all your Facebook friends’ photo albums in one place. No more clicking on friends, waiting for the page to load, then navigating to their photo page. Now all your friends’ photos are a single click away.

And if there are a bunch of Facebook photos you want to keep, you can use MediaShow to download them as a batch for even more time saving.

Perhaps the most time consuming aspect of uploading photos to Facebook is having to painstakingly tag all your friends in them. MediaShow’s FaceMe™ technology is highly accurate at recognizing faces in your photos and automatically tagging them for you. You can then upload the pre-tagged photos to Facebook right from MediaShow.
